When should I seek local service for a Volkswagen Check Engine light in Cedar Rapids?

Seek immediate diagnostic service if the light is flashing, indicating a severe misfire that could damage the catalytic converter. For a steady light, schedule a scan soon, as issues like faulty oxygen sensors or emissions components are common and can affect fuel efficiency on long rural drives.

What local factors should Cedar Rapids VW owners consider for maintenance?

The dusty, unpaved country roads necessitate more frequent cabin air and engine air filter changes. Additionally, using a coolant mix appropriate for Nebraska's hot summers and cold winters is crucial to protect the VW's aluminum engine from temperature-related stress.
